Face Covering Update
As per Government regulations, from Friday 24th July, guests will be required to wear a face covering if they wish to enter our Gift Shop & General Store.
**EDIT** Government guidance amended as of 23rd July (in the evening) this also now applies to indoor take away areas. For our site this will include Rays Diner and Loves Grove. If you are then eating in our indoor seating area masks may be removed.
**EDIT** As per updated Government guidance from Saturday 8th August face masks will also be required to be worn in our Reception area.
Face coverings are not required for all other areas of the park. However, guests are more than welcome to wear one if they wish. Reusable face masks can be purchased at our Entrance Kiosks, Reception and catering outlets.
You do not need to wear a face covering in the areas stated above if you have a legitimate reason not to.
This includes:
• Young children under the age of 11
• Not being able to put on, wear or remove a face covering because of a physical or mental illness/impairment or disability
• If putting on, wearing or removing a face covering will cause you severe distress
• If you are travelling with or providing assistance to someone who relies on lip reading to communicate
• To avoid harm or injury, or the risk of harm or injury, to yourself or others.

(Updated 20th March 2020 @ 3.30pm)
In response to the current situation developing regarding Covid-19 and the most recent advice from the UK Government and Public Health England we are extremely sorry to announce that Woodlands Family Theme Park and Woodlands Caravan and Camping Park will be closed until further notice.
This is not a decision that has been made easily having already implemented many additional measures to protect both our guests, staff and suppliers. However, at this point in time we feel this is the only and correct course of action available to us in order to limit social interaction in line with the recommendations laid out by the Government.
We know this will be disappointing news, particularly to those who have planned a visit soon with us, but as a family run business the health and well-being of our guests and staff is, and always has been, our top priority and we hope you understand and support our decision to close.
